1. d4 d5 2. c4 dxc4 3. Nf3 Nf6 4. e3 e6 5. Bxc4 c5 6. O-O a6 7. a3 b5 8. Ba2 Bb7 9. Nc3 cxd4 10. exd4 Be7 11. Bg5 O-O 12. Qd3 Nbd7 13. Rad1 Nb6 14. Ne5 Nbd5 15. Rfe1 Nxc3 16. bxc3 Nd5 17. Bb1 f5 18. Bd2 Bg5 19. c4 Bxd2 20. Qxd2 bxc4 21. Nxc4 Rc8 22. Ba2 Rf6 23. Rb1 Ba8 24. Rec1 f4 25. Ne5 Rxc1+ 26. Rxc1 Rf8 27. Qd3 Qd6 28. Bb1 Nf6 29. Ng4 g6 30. Nxf6+ Rxf6 31. f3 Rf8 32. h3 Rd8 33. Kh2 Kg7 34. Ba2 Qxd4 35. Qxa6 Bxf3 36. Qxe6 Qd2 37. Qe7+ Kh6 38. Qh4+ Bh5 39. Rc5 Qd4 40. Qg5+ Kg7 41. Qe7+ Kh6 42. h4 1–0

About this game
This chess game between Colin S Crouch (2343) and Peter J Vas (2293) was played at 4NCL in 2011 and finished 1–0. The opening was the Queen's Gambit Accepted: Classical Defense, Russian Gambit (D27).
